Add 54/21 and 30/6

1st number: 2 12/21, 2nd number: 5 0/6

54/21 + 30/6 is 53/7.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 21 and 6 is 42

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 42
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 21 × 2 = 42,
    54/21 = 54 × 2/21 × 2 = 108/42
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 6 × 7 = 42,
    30/6 = 30 × 7/6 × 7 = 210/42
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    108/42 + 210/42 = 108 + 210/42 = 318/42
  5. 318/42 simplified gives 53/7
  6. So, 54/21 + 30/6 = 53/7
